COMMERCE BUSINESS DAILY ISSUE OF AUGUST 16,1995 PSA#1411

Navy Aviation Supply Office, 700 Robbins Avenue Philadelphia, Pa 19111-5098

14 -- SOL N0038395YT065 DUE 100395 POC Contact Point, Anne M Crankshaw, 0235.08, (215)697-4377, Fax, (215)697-3161, Twx, Not-avail The subject item requires Government source approval prior to contract award, as the item is flight critical and /or the technical data available has not been determined adequate to support acquisition via full and open competition. Only the source(s) previously approved by the government for this item have been solicited. The time required for approval of a new source is normally such that award cannot be delayed pending approval of a new source. If you are not an approved source you must submit, together with your proposal, the information detailed in the U.S. Navy Aviation Supply Office Source Approval Information Brochure. This brochure identifies technical data required to be submitted based on your company's experience in production of the same or similar item, or if this is an item you have never made. This brochure can be obtained by calling A.S.O. at (215) 697-4243. If your request for source approval is currently being evaluated at ASO, submit with your offer a copy of the cover letter which forwarded your request for source approval. Offers received which fail to provide all data required by the Source Approval Brochure or document previous submission of all data required by the Source Approval Brochure will not be considered for award under this solicitation. Please note, if evaluation of a source approval request submitted hereunder cannot be processed in time and/or approval requirements preclude the ability to obtain subject items in time to meet government requirements, award of the subject requirement may continue based on Fleet support needs. NSN 7R-1420-01-343-7101-BM, Qty 21 EA, Delivery FOB Origin -----This requirement is for a two-year requirements contract with three one-yearoptions for repair of various Target Auxiliary Augmentation Systems Equipment (TA/AS)for BQM-34 and BQM-74 Aircraft. Due to the requirement for potential offerors to undergo an extensive repair qualification process in order to demonstrate repair capability, the source for this buy is restricted to Herley-Vega Systems, a division of Herley Industries, Inc. Any other interested parties should contact ASO Source Development at (215) 697-5717 for information regarding technical qualification for future procurements. The following are some of the items to be repaired: NSN 7R 1420 013437101 BM, Transponder Set, 21 EA; NSN 7R1420 013399409 RM, Transponder Set, 36 EA; NSN 7R 1420 013421534 RM, 21 EA; NSN7R 5895 013655718 BM, Receiver, Radio, 6 EA; NSN 7R 5895 013665006 QM, Detector, Video Sign, 3 EA., See Note 22 (0226)
